China's oil consumption fell 9% year over year in the second quarter as high crude prices accelerated the shift to electric vehicles and alternative transport; the decline signals sustained structural headwinds for oil demand in the world's second-largest consumer.
The market transmission
A 9% quarterly drop in Chinese oil demand is material to the global crude balance, especially if the shift persists beyond the current price regime. The read is not straightforward: if high prices drove the substitution, lower prices could partially reverse it, but the embedded trend toward electrification in transport and industrial applications represents a secular pressure on crude that competing production sources cannot offset with supply cuts alone. Coal-fired generation rising 3% in the power sector complicates the energy transition narrative and leaves overall emissions flat rather than sharply lower, suggesting the oil displacement is real but not part of a coordinated decarbonization.

The mechanism is price-driven substitution rather than policy mandate, which means the effect is cyclical as well as structural. A durable 9% drop in the world's largest incremental demand centre is significant, but the signal does not distinguish between permanent modal shift (EV adoption, rail electrification, industrial fuel switching) and temporary demand destruction from high prices. If crude prices fall materially, some demand may return. Power-sector coal gains also suggest energy policy is not uniformly aimed at oil displacement, complicating the sustainability of the trend.
